Estonian government approves 7.6 percent pension increase

The Estonian government on Thursday endorsed a regulation that will increase pensions and the workability allowance in Estonia by an average of 7.6 percent beginning April 1.

The new value of the pension index, according to the regulation, is 1.076. This means an increase of 7.6 percent on average in pensions and the daily rate of the workability allowance.
